Escalation in Syria: UN Secretary General called to immediately stop violence Peace and safety ~ 60 > UN Secretary General Antoniu Gutererish expressed deep concern with a sharp exacerbation of the situation in the coastal regions of Syria. Mass killings, the destruction of infrastructure and the death of civilians, including women, children and medical workers, cause him serious anxiety. Among the victims, it was reported, is an employee of the Middle East Agency of the UN to help Palestinian refugees (Bapor). Guterres expressed condolences to the Syrians who have lost loved ones, and called on all aspects of the conflict to immediately stop violence, abandon the inciting hatred of rhetoric and ensure the protection of the civilian population. ~ 60 > humanitarian crisis: thousands of people flee to Lebanon ~ 60 > conflict escalation has already led to large -scale humanitarian consequences. According to the UN, hundreds of people were killed, thousands were forced to leave their homes, and many of them crossed the border with Lebanon in search of safety. In Latakia and Tartus, the schools are temporarily closed, interruptions with the supply of water and electricity are observed in the region. ~ 60 > In addition, civil infrastructure is damaged, including six hospitals and several ambulances.
